Ryan Mosley
Ryan Mosley was born in Chesterfield in 1980. After studying at Chesterfield College of Art and Design, University of Huddersfield, the artist also completed a postgraduate degree at the Royal College of Art, London in 2007. During his studies, Mosley worked as a security guard at London's National Gallery. Days spent surrounded by the works of the Old Masters became one of the sources of inspiration in his own creative practice. Mosley synthesises artistic styles and movements, creating quaint works that combine modernity with a reference to eternal themes. The artist does not sketch, but instead uses a brush as a pencil to create large-scale works with layers of translucent washes. Mosley's works are filled with fantasy and theatre scenes, ambiguous and intriguing. The artist prefers to create a series of works, his paintings often form a coherent narrative that can be seen as a single work. In 2009, the first solo exhibition of Ryan Mosley in Russia took place at the OVCHARENKO Gallery (until 2018 Regina).
